Transaction 77e65cdb355314e68e8f05c48b087f6076d4b32296c6bc317776841e8958d40a
2 Input
2 Outputs
- 77e65cdb355314e68e8f05c48b087f6076d4b32296c6bc317776841e8958d40a:0
- 77e65cdb355314e68e8f05c48b087f6076d4b32296c6bc317776841e8958d40a:1
value 1862
address 14npFFGfExwXUJ9QNveVoijQHCkbMzATys
value 1260672
address 1GWJuiWA2kZ4HSZM2H1wmuhinpy1nAhRHD